Australia - Import of Nuclear Reactors
In 2018, the country was number 51 comparing other countries in Import of Nuclear Reactors at $1,146.48. Australia is overtaken by Denmark, which was ranked number 50 at $1,223.82 and is followed by Senegal at $1,144. United Arab Emirates lead the ranking with $37,770,196 in 2017, that is +303.2% versus 2016. Mexico, Netherlands and Thailand resp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Mexico witnessed the best average annual growth at +478.9% per year, while Brazil was the worst growing country at -84.4% per year.
